Country Director, Poland

Google

Warszawa

Minimum qualifications: 15 years of experience in sales leadership, and experience in general management in technology, advertising, or Internet industries. Experience driving revenue performance and growing businesses in Poland. Experience in people management and cross-functional leadership. Experience working in multinational, matrixed organizations. Experience working with diverse stakeholders, including business leaders, community organizations, or government entities. Ability to communicate in Polish and English fluently to communicate with and serve Polish speaking customers. Preferred qualifications: Experience as a regional/country manager, or in cross-cultural or multi-market leadership. Experience leading executive-level customer conversations, translating complex AI capabilities into tangible business value and long-term ROI. Ability to set business plans and sales strategy, and take ownership of driving commercial activities. Ability to focus and prioritize in a fast-growing business environment, particularly for revenue-generating activities. Ability to learn Google products to understand value proposition and growth potential. Excellent analytical acumen and thought leadership. About the jobBusinesses that partner with Google come in all shapes, sizes and market caps, and no one Google advertising solution works for all. As a Country Director, you work with customers and market influencers to establish long-term visions for advertisers, publishers and partners. You partner with the Sales leadership team to set strategic objectives and run the country’s day-to-day operations. You deeply understand the context of the market, and set visions that inspire your organization. Within Google, you are the primary advocate of your country. You share the opportunities and challenges of the market, and voice the priorities for our products. Within region, you set transparent objectives, collaborate with your functional counterparts and execute. You are an excellent communicator with a proven ability to train and motivate a large team. You use an analytical approach to sales management to develop and grow some of the most significant agencies and businesses in the market.As the Country Director, you will lead a highly skilled and ambitious commercial team. You'll drive how businesses and consumers view Google, and shape how new and existing businesses grow. You will use an analytical approach to sales leadership to develop and grow some of the most significant start-ups, exporters, and businesses in the market.Google's Large Customer Sales (LCS) teams are strategic partners and industry thought leaders to the world's leading brands and agencies. We continuously challenge how customers think about their business and how Google can support growth. We focus on helping these players navigate profound industry shifts and drive outsized business performance by competitively selling Google's full suite of advertising solutions across Search, YouTube, Measurement, and more. As a member of our LCS team, you'll have the unique opportunity to sell at the forefront of technology, collaborating with executives, influencing market-shaping strategies, and delivering tangible results that significantly impact major global businesses and drive the growth of Google.Responsibilities Lead sales and commercial operations to deliver business growth, with a focus on large advertisers. Build key external relationships to open up business opportunities.  Represent Google in the market beyond business relationships as needed and represent the country to Google (e.g., product challenges and opportunities). Lead cross-functionally, bringing teams together around an integrated plan for Google’s success in the market. Establish strong relationships with senior level individuals in the advertising ecosystem. Meet and exceed country business goals. Prospect, qualify, negotiate, and assist the team in closing these key accounts. Google is proud to be an equal opportunity workplace and is an affirmative action employer.
